The Reality of Wrist-Based Blood Pressure

So, the big question: do any fitness trackers measure blood pressure? The truth is, most consumer-grade fitness trackers and smartwatches do NOT measure blood pressure directly and accurately in the way a medical-grade cuff does. What you’ll often find are devices that use optical sensors (like those for heart rate) to estimate blood pressure. This estimation is based on pulse wave transit time (PWTT) or similar algorithms. It’s a clever piece of engineering, no doubt, but it’s not the same as a direct measurement.

Think of it like this: a chef can tell if a soup is salty by tasting it (direct measurement). An AI could potentially analyze the chemical composition of the soup from a photo and *estimate* the salt content (indirect estimation). One is far more precise and reliable for its intended purpose. For blood pressure, that direct measurement is what matters clinically. (See Also: How Accurate Are Fitness Trackers Calories?)

The readings from these trackers are often presented as ‘trends’ or ‘estimates.’ They might give you a general idea of whether your blood pressure is trending up or down over time, which can be a mild alert. However, they are not designed for diagnostic purposes or for making treatment decisions. The American Heart Association, for instance, has consistently stated that wrist-based devices are not yet a substitute for traditional cuffs for accurate blood pressure monitoring.

Why Most Skip Direct Blood Pressure Measurement

The technology required for accurate, cuffless blood pressure monitoring is complex and, frankly, bulky. Medical-grade devices use an inflatable cuff that squeezes your arm to get a precise reading. Replicating that precision without a physical cuff is incredibly difficult. The subtle changes in blood flow and vessel elasticity that influence blood pressure readings are hard to capture reliably through optical sensors alone, especially with movement, skin tone variations, and even how tightly you wear the watch.

Companies that *do* offer blood pressure features on their devices often go through extensive regulatory approval processes, like FDA clearance in the US or CE marking in Europe. These devices typically still require calibration with a traditional cuff and are meant for tracking trends, not for replacing your doctor’s advice. Some high-end smartwatches, like certain Samsung Galaxy Watch models, have gained these approvals in specific regions, but even then, they are not universally available and often have limitations.

Is There a Watch That Monitors Blood Pressure Continuously?

Currently, there isn’t a consumer smartwatch that provides continuous, medically accurate blood pressure monitoring without a cuff. Technologies are advancing, and research is ongoing for cuffless, continuous monitoring, but these are not yet widely available or proven reliable enough for daily, uninterrupted use. Most devices offering blood pressure features do so on-demand or at scheduled intervals, often requiring manual activation and calibration.
